Automatizando o encaminhamento de e-mail em VBA: personalizando linhas de assunto

VBA

Aprimorando a automação de e-mail com VBA

Visual Basic for Applications (VBA) é uma ferramenta poderosa para automatizar tarefas repetitivas em aplicativos do Microsoft Office, aumentando significativamente a produtividade e a eficiência. Entre sua vasta gama de recursos, a automação de e-mail, especialmente no Microsoft Outlook, é um recurso de destaque. Essa automação envolve o encaminhamento programático de e-mails e a personalização de linhas de assunto, uma funcionalidade que pode agilizar os fluxos de trabalho e garantir que informações críticas sejam prontamente compartilhadas. Ao aproveitar o VBA, os usuários podem automatizar o processo de encaminhamento de e-mails para endereços específicos, uma tarefa que, de outra forma, exigiria esforço manual e tempo considerável.

Além disso, a capacidade de adicionar texto específico à linha de assunto de um e-mail, incluindo uma parte do endereço de e-mail do remetente, introduz uma camada de personalização e organização. Esse recurso pode ser particularmente útil em cenários onde os e-mails precisam ser categorizados ou sinalizados com base na identidade do remetente, auxiliando na identificação e no processamento mais rápidos. Através de scripts VBA práticos, os usuários podem implementar essas melhorias com precisão, adaptando o processo de encaminhamento de e-mail para atender às suas necessidades e fluxos de trabalho específicos, abrindo assim novas possibilidades para gerenciar comunicações por e-mail de forma mais eficaz.

Simplificando processos de e-mail

O gerenciamento de e-mail muitas vezes pode se tornar uma parte tediosa de nossas rotinas diárias, principalmente quando envolve tarefas repetitivas, como encaminhar e-mails e modificar linhas de assunto. Visual Basic for Applications (VBA) oferece uma solução poderosa para automatizar esses processos diretamente em seu cliente de e-mail, como o Microsoft Outlook. Ao aproveitar os recursos do VBA, você pode agilizar significativamente seu fluxo de trabalho de e-mail, economizando tempo e reduzindo o potencial de erro humano.

Esta introdução se aprofundará em como o VBA pode ser utilizado para encaminhar e-mails automaticamente para um endereço especificado e, ao mesmo tempo, adicionar texto personalizado à linha de assunto que inclui uma parte do endereço de e-mail do remetente. Essa técnica é particularmente útil para organizar e-mails, rastrear correspondências de remetentes específicos e garantir que mensagens importantes sejam redirecionadas para onde precisam, sem intervenção manual.

Comando Descrição
CreateItemFromTemplate Cria um novo item de correio com base em um modelo especificado.
MailItem.Forward Gera uma cópia encaminhada do item de correio.
MailItem.Subject Permite modificação da linha de assunto do email.
MailItem.Send Envia o item de correio para o destinatário especificado.

Aprimorando a automação de e-mail com VBA

A automação de email via Visual Basic for Applications (VBA) não é apenas uma questão de conveniência; representa um avanço significativo na forma como indivíduos e organizações gerenciam suas comunicações digitais. Os scripts VBA podem automatizar várias tarefas relacionadas a e-mail, como classificação de e-mails, gerenciamento de anexos e até mesmo resposta automática a tipos específicos de mensagens. Este nível de automação é particularmente benéfico para empresas onde a comunicação por e-mail é frequente e volumosa, permitindo um tratamento mais eficiente de consultas de clientes, confirmações de pedidos e comunicações internas. Ao automatizar esses processos, as organizações podem garantir respostas oportunas, manter altos níveis de atendimento ao cliente e liberar tempo valioso para que os funcionários se concentrem em tarefas mais complexas.

O processo de configuração do encaminhamento de e-mail e personalização da linha de assunto usando VBA envolve a escrita de scripts que interagem com o back-end do cliente de e-mail. Essa interação permite ajustes dinâmicos em emails com base em critérios predefinidos, como informações do remetente, palavras-chave na linha de assunto ou tipos específicos de anexos. Por exemplo, um script VBA pode ser projetado para encaminhar automaticamente todos os e-mails de um cliente específico para um membro designado da equipe, ao mesmo tempo que adiciona o nome ou empresa do cliente à linha de assunto para facilitar a identificação. Isso não apenas agiliza o fluxo de trabalho, mas também garante que e-mails importantes sejam prontamente direcionados à pessoa certa, aumentando a eficiência e a eficácia geral da comunicação por e-mail dentro de uma organização.

Automatizando o encaminhamento de e-mail com VBA

Microsoft Outlook VBA

Dim originalEmail As MailItem
Set originalEmail = Application.ActiveExplorer.Selection.Item(1)
Dim forwardEmail As MailItem
Set forwardEmail = originalEmail.Forward()
forwardEmail.Subject = "FW: " & originalEmail.Subject & " - " & originalEmail.SenderEmailAddress
forwardEmail.Recipients.Add "specificaddress@example.com"
forwardEmail.Send

Aprimorando o gerenciamento de e-mail por meio do VBA

Visual Basic for Applications (VBA) é uma ferramenta significativa para automatizar tarefas repetitivas no Microsoft Outlook, incluindo encaminhamento de email e personalização de linha de assunto. Esse recurso não apenas simplifica o gerenciamento de e-mail, mas também aumenta a produtividade ao automatizar tarefas que, de outra forma, exigiriam esforço manual. Por exemplo, usando scripts VBA, os usuários podem definir critérios para encaminhamento automático de e-mail, como encaminhar todos os e-mails de um remetente específico ou conter palavras-chave específicas na linha de assunto. Essa automação garante que e-mails importantes não sejam perdidos e sejam direcionados sem demora para a pessoa ou departamento apropriado.

Além disso, adicionar informações específicas do remetente à linha de assunto dos emails encaminhados pode melhorar significativamente a organização e a priorização dos emails. Este método permite que os destinatários identifiquem rapidamente o contexto e a urgência do e-mail sem abri-lo. É particularmente benéfico para equipes que lidam com um grande volume de e-mails, como atendimento ao cliente ou departamentos de vendas. Ao implementar scripts VBA para essas tarefas, as organizações podem obter um sistema de gerenciamento de e-mail mais eficiente, levando a melhores fluxos de comunicação e tempos de resposta.

Perguntas frequentes sobre automação de e-mail com VBA

  1. O VBA pode automatizar o encaminhamento de e-mail para vários destinatários?
  2. Sim, o VBA pode automatizar o encaminhamento de email para vários destinatários adicionando o endereço de email de cada destinatário à coleção Recipients do objeto MailItem.
  3. É possível personalizar o conteúdo do email encaminhado com VBA?
  4. Sim, você pode personalizar a linha de assunto e o corpo do e-mail encaminhado usando VBA para incluir texto ou informações adicionais conforme necessário.
  5. Como posso garantir que meu script VBA seja executado automaticamente?
  6. Você pode acionar seu script VBA para ser executado automaticamente com base em eventos específicos no Outlook, como a chegada de novos e-mails, utilizando manipuladores de eventos como NewMailEx.
  7. Os scripts VBA podem ser usados ​​para gerenciar emails em caixas de correio compartilhadas?
  8. Sim, os scripts VBA podem interagir com caixas de correio compartilhadas, permitindo automatizar o encaminhamento de e-mail e outras tarefas de gerenciamento em um ambiente colaborativo.
  9. Há alguma preocupação de segurança com o uso do VBA para automação de e-mail?
  10. Embora o VBA em si seja seguro, é crucial garantir que os scripts sejam escritos e executados com segurança para evitar a exposição do seu sistema a possíveis riscos de segurança, como a execução de código malicioso.

Utilizar o Visual Basic for Applications (VBA) para automatizar o encaminhamento de e-mail e a personalização da linha de assunto representa um salto significativo na otimização do gerenciamento de e-mail. Essa abordagem não apenas economiza um tempo valioso ao reduzir o manuseio manual de e-mails, mas também aumenta a confiabilidade dos fluxos de comunicação dentro das organizações. Ao configurar scripts VBA para encaminhar e-mails automaticamente e incluir informações pertinentes do remetente na linha de assunto, as empresas podem garantir que mensagens críticas nunca sejam esquecidas e que as equipes possam identificar rapidamente os e-mails mais importantes. Além disso, a adaptabilidade do VBA permite que os scripts sejam adaptados para atender aos requisitos exclusivos de qualquer equipe, fornecendo uma solução personalizável para os desafios de gerenciamento de e-mail. No geral, a integração do VBA nos processos de e-mail permite que os usuários mantenham um alto nível de eficiência e organização em suas comunicações, contribuindo, em última análise, para operações mais tranquilas e maior produtividade.